Mastering CBSE Class 10th Social Science: Strategies for a Perfect Score

Scoring 100 in the CBSE Class 10th Social Science exam is not just about memorizing information; it requires a strategic approach to studying and preparation. Here are some tips to help you achieve that perfect score.

Understand the Syllabus

The first step is to familiarize yourself with the CBSE Class 10 Social Science syllabus. This includes key topics in History, Geography, Political Science, and Economics. Understanding the syllabus will help you focus your study efforts on the most important areas.

Create a Study Plan

A well-structured timetable is essential for systematically covering all the topics. Allocate specific time slots for each subject and topic. This will ensure that you don't miss any important areas and that your preparation is evenly distributed.

Use NCERT Textbooks

Stick to NCERT textbooks as they are the primary source for CBSE exams. These books are designed to cover the entire syllabus and provide a solid foundation for the exam. Read each chapter thoroughly and make sure you understand the concepts.

Make Notes

While studying, create concise notes for each chapter. Highlight key points, dates, events, and definitions. Use bullet points for clarity. This will make your notes more organized and easier to remember.

Practice Previous Years' Papers

Solving past years' question papers and sample papers is crucial. This will help you get familiar with the exam pattern and understand the types of questions that are frequently asked. It also helps in managing time effectively during the exam.

Focus on Important Topics

Identify and prioritize essential topics that carry more weight in the exam. Pay attention to chapters that have been emphasized in previous papers. These areas are likely to be more significant in terms of marks.

Revise Regularly

Regular revisions are key to reinforcing your memory and understanding of the material. Schedule periodic revisions of your notes and key concepts. This will help solidify your knowledge and ensure that you retain the information.

Group Study

Engage in group study sessions to discuss and clarify doubts. Teaching others is a great way to reinforce your own understanding. Group discussions can also provide different perspectives and insights that may not have occurred to you before.

Use Visual Aids

Utilize maps, charts, and diagrams to visualize information better, especially for Geography and History. This can enhance retention and make the information more memorable. Visual aids can also help you explain complex concepts more effectively.

Stay Updated

For Political Science and Current Affairs, keep yourself updated with recent events and their relevance to your syllabus. Stay informed through news channels, newspapers, and current affairs magazines. This will help you integrate current events with the history and politics that you study.

Practice Answer Writing

Develop your answer writing skills. Focus on presenting answers clearly and concisely. Include relevant examples and diagrams where necessary. Good answer writing not only helps in scoring more marks but also makes your preparation more organized.

Time Management

During the exam, manage your time effectively. Allocate time for each section and avoid spending too long on any single question. This will help you maintain a balance and ensure that you cover all the questions in the time allotted.

Stay Healthy

Maintain a healthy lifestyle with proper nutrition, exercise, and sleep. A healthy body supports a sharp mind. Eating well and exercising regularly can enhance your cognitive functions and help you stay focused during study hours.

Stay Positive and Confident

Cultivate a positive mindset. Confidence can significantly impact your performance during preparation and the exam. Believe in yourself and the effort you have put in, and it will boost your chances of achieving a perfect score.

By following these strategies, you can enhance your preparation and improve your chances of scoring 100 in your CBSE Class 10th Social Science exam. Good luck!
